I am perfectly aware that there has been a post on this lost Tiki gem, but The Castaways has some amazing atributes. There is a pirate's treasure, a captain's table ( with fire blazing out of a pile of quartz crystal, under what once was a ship's boiler ), private tiki hut for six, awsome Tikis and a cool indoor water feature. Opon our leaving there was an Old Timer playing some very creepy standards on keyboard whilst singing.
